cmd/internal/objabi: extract shared functionality from obj
Now only cmd/asm and cmd/compile depend on cmd/internal/obj. Changing the assembler backends no longer requires reinstalling cmd/link or cmd/addr2line. There's also now one canonical definition of the object file format in cmd/internal/objabi/doc.go, with a warning to update all three implementations. objabi is still something of a grab bag of unrelated code (e.g., flag and environment variable handling probably belong in a separate "tool" package), but this is still progress. Fixes #15165. Fixes #20026.
